That balance is one of the strengths of Shattered Energy: A Memory in Time by Athena Plencner.

Ariyana appears to have an ordinary life. She is raising twin boys, trying to hold together a strained marriage, and struggling to understand the vivid dream that has haunted her since childhood. Night after night, she relives the same devastating memory, watching her dragon-like companion, Glacin, perish at the hands of terrifying insect-like creatures. She wakes each morning with the lingering certainty that somehow it all feels real.

On her 30th birthday, she discovers that it is.

As the boundaries between dream and reality collapse, Ariyana learns that the visions she has carried for decades are actually fragments of a forgotten past. Suddenly, she finds herself hunted by powerful enemies while racing to uncover the truth about who she really is before the people she loves are placed in danger.

Although the novel offers imaginative creatures, exciting action, and an expansive fantasy world, its greatest strength lies in its emotional core. At its heart, Shattered Energy is a story about identity, memory, family, and the choices we make when the past refuses to remain buried. Readers uncover each revelation alongside Ariyana, making every discovery feel personal.

The novel has already earned praise from reviewers. Kirkus Reviews noted, “There’s action aplenty in Plencner’s novel,” while Midwest Book Review described it as “a cut above many McCaffrey stories,” praising its ability to entertain while remaining thought-provoking.

Athena Plencner grew up on the East Coast before making Southern California her home. When she isn’t writing fantasy, she’s often exploring the outdoors, finding inspiration on hiking trails and long runs. That sense of exploration carries naturally into her fiction, where imaginative worlds are grounded by believable characters and genuine emotional stakes. Shattered Energy: A Memory in Time is her debut novel, introducing readers to a new fantasy series that promises adventure while never losing sight of the people at its center.
